Popular Uses of Barrel Decor

One of the reasons barrel decor has become so popular is its versatility. From coffee tables to planters, to storage solutions, there is no limit to how these sturdy and stylish pieces can be used. Let’s explore some popular uses that have taken the world of interior design by storm.

  1. Barrel Tables
    Imagine hosting a dinner party with a repurposed oak barrel as your table centerpiece. A barrel table can serve as a unique dining table, side table, or even a coffee table. The sturdy wood construction not only adds a rustic touch but also makes for a durable piece that can withstand heavy use. Barrel tables are particularly popular in wine cellars, tasting rooms, and home bars, where they bring an added sense of authenticity to the space.
  2. Barrel Planters
    For outdoor enthusiasts, barrel decor also shines in garden spaces. Large barrels cut in half make for excellent planters. The natural wood look blends seamlessly into outdoor environments, while the durable construction can withstand the elements. Barrel planters add a natural, organic touch to your garden, deck, or patio and can be used to house everything from flowers to small trees.

  1. Barrel Storage Solutions
    Another fantastic use of barrel decor is as a storage solution. Whether you’re looking for a unique piece to store your wine collection or a creative way to keep firewood, barrels provide ample space while maintaining a stylish appearance. Many people also repurpose barrels as coolers, adding a lid and some ice to transform them into drink storage for outdoor gatherings.
  2. Barrel Bar Stools and Chairs
    Perfect for rustic kitchens, man caves, or outdoor bar setups, barrel stools and chairs offer both comfort and style. Often, the natural curve of the barrel can be used to create ergonomic seating, making them not only visually appealing but also practical for everyday use. The rich tones of the wood can complement a variety of design aesthetics, from industrial to farmhouse chic.
  3. Barrel Lighting
    Looking for a statement lighting piece? Barrel decor can even extend to chandeliers and pendant lights. Barrel rings or staves can be reconfigured to create stunning light fixtures that add an element of rustic elegance to any room. These pieces are perfect for dining rooms, entryways, or even outdoor patios, where they bring warmth and a sense of uniqueness to the space.

  • Eco-Friendly: Repurposing old barrels into functional pieces is a great way to reduce waste and make use of sustainable materials. Instead of discarding these well-crafted objects, turning them into decor gives them a second life.
  • Durability: Barrels are made to last. Typically constructed from high-quality hardwoods like oak, these pieces are incredibly durable and can stand up to the test of time. This makes them perfect for both indoor and outdoor use.
  • Unique Appeal: No two barrels are exactly alike, which means every piece of barrel decor you add to your home is one-of-a-kind. The wood grain, color variations, and even markings from its previous life add character and history to your decor.
  • Timeless Design: Rustic, vintage, and farmhouse aesthetics never go out of style. Barrel decor can complement both traditional and contemporary designs, making it a versatile option that you can adapt as trends change.

Incorporating Barrel Decor into Commercial Spaces

It’s not just homes that are benefiting from the unique charm of barrel decor. Commercial spaces such as restaurants, cafes, and wineries have also embraced this trend. Barrel tables, seating, and decorative pieces add an authentic, welcoming feel to these environments, making them memorable for visitors. Wineries, in particular, find barrel decor fitting for their tasting rooms, as it evokes the history and tradition of winemaking.

Restaurants and cafes also use barrel decor to create a cozy, intimate atmosphere. Imagine walking into a café with barrel planters and tables—it immediately sets the tone for a laid-back, rustic dining experience. For businesses in the hospitality industry, barrel decor not only adds to the aesthetic but also serves as a conversation piece for guests.
